Ampoules and serums have similar functions, but differ in concentration and purpose. Serums are ideal for daily use, with concentrated active ingredients such as hyaluronic acid, vitamin C, and peptides, helping to address hydration, radiance, and signs of aging. Ampoules have an even higher concentration of actives, acting as intensive treatments for specific concerns such as dark spots, acne, or deep wrinkles, usually used in short or weekly cycles. While ampoules deliver fast results, serums maintain continuous care. When used together, ampoules and serums enhance firmness, evenness, radiance, and overall skin health.
Choosing the right ampoule depends on the treatment goal. For intense hydration, opt for ampoules with hyaluronic acid, glycerin, or panthenol. To even out skin tone, look for vitamin C, niacinamide, or tranexamic acid. Anti-aging treatments benefit from retinol, peptides, or coenzyme Q10, while oil control and acne require salicylic acid or zinc. Assess skin sensitivity and follow the manufacturer’s recommendations. Applying the ampoule to clean skin, before moisturizer, ensures maximum absorption and visible results such as radiance, evenness, and firmness.

Frequency depends on the formulation and skin sensitivity. Intensive ampoules are generally used 1 to 3 times per week, while gentler versions can be applied daily. Products with retinol or concentrated acids require alternating use to avoid irritation.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ions, applying to clean, toned skin before serum and moisturizer. Consistent and controlled application ensures effective absorption and visible results such as deep hydration, even skin tone, and improved texture.
